Welcome to the show where everything goes wrong, historically. A podcast covering disasters of all kinds throughout history. From tornadoes and earthquakes to mining disasters and arson. From the perspective of a professional fire investigator, I provide the history of the area, a breakdown of how and why the disaster occurs, a timeline of the event, and the resulting aftermath. What is This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Content centers around various historical disasters, covering a wide range of catastrophic events including natural disasters like tornadoes and earthquakes, as well as man-made tragedies such as fires and accidents. The narrative takes a unique approach by incorporating the viewpoint of a professional fire investigator, offering both technical analysis and rich historical context for each incident. Each episode typically includes personal stories, detailed timelines, and the social implications of these events, making it not only informative but also engaging for listeners interested in history, safety, and the lessons learned from past disasters.
